Fangirl Author Signs Two Book Deal

Rainbow Rowell, author of Fangirl and Eleanor & Park has signed a two book deal with First Second. The books will be YA graphic novels. Rainbow Rowell signs two-book deal with First Second

Literary Awards for Children's Authors Announced

Kate DiCamillo, Brian Floca, and Marcus Sedgwick are award prestigious literary awards for their recent novels. Read more about these and other honorary mentions:
